Most significant events in you life

I have to say moving to Phoenix at the beginning of second semester of 10th grade and starting at West High and meeting the friends that I did. For if that hadn't happened I would not have met Larry Martin, fell in love with him and married him right after graduation with our only child, Jay born 1 year later. Unfortunately our marriage did not last but our friendship did until his tragic and untimely death.

Equally significant was meeting the second love of my life , my current husband, Jim Grayson, who has been my rock through the bad times and the good times. He has been there for the joys in raising Jay and the delights of sharing a beautiful granddaughter and on February 18, 2017 we celebrated our 40th anniversary with a trip to the Grand Canyon and Sedona.

I did try a career in business but did not find that a fit wIth my M.A. in Anthropology so i entered the non profit arena where I found my home. I retired in 2015 after a 35 year career as a non profit CEO/Admistrator for several organizations, including Southwest Museum, Camp Fire, the L.S.B. Leakey Foundation, American Humanics, Neighborhood Partnership Housing Services, and most recently the California Fire Safe Council, a statewide corporation dedicated to the prevention of wildfires in the state of California through education, planning and prevention activities. In addition I have always found time to volunteer for other non profits.

Currently my husband Jim & I are Docents at The Autry Museum of The American West and have great fun providing museum tours for school children on a weekly basis. And, I'm also a member of the Board of Directors of a transitional housing shelter near our home.
